The size of LCD refers to the diagonal distance of the screen. Internationally, 1 inch =2.54cm. Display generally refers to the diagonal size of the picture tube, which refers to the size of the picture tube, not its display area, but for the user, he is concerned about his visual area, that is, the actual size of the picture tube that can be seen, in inches.
Generally speaking, the visual area of a 15 inch display is 13.8 inch, that of a 17 inch display is 16 inch, and that of a 19 inch display is 18 inch.

Disadvantages of display screen:
(1) The visual deflection angle is small;
(2) It is easy to cause image tailing (for example, the mouse pointer shakes rapidly). This is because ordinary LCD screens are mostly 60Hz (displaying 60 frames per second), but this problem mainly appears in games where LCD monitors have just become popular (that is, "picture tearing");
(The brightness and contrast of LCD are not very good;
(4) the "bad spot" problem of liquid crystal;
(5) Limited service life;
(6) When the resolution is lower than the default resolution of the display, the picture blur will be very obvious;
(7) When the resolution is greater than the default resolution of the display (mandatory setting by software is required), the colors in the details will be lost.
